one. Introduction to URL Shortening
URL shortening is a way on the web wherein a lengthy URL could be converted right into a shorter, much more manageable type. This shortened URL redirects to the original long URL when frequented. Products and services like Bitly and TinyURL are very well-identified samples of URL shorteners. The need for URL shortening arose with the appearance of social websites platforms like Twitter, wherever character boundaries for posts produced it challenging to share lengthy URLs.

2. Core Elements of the URL Shortener
A URL shortener typically is made up of the subsequent parts:

Web Interface: This is the entrance-conclusion part in which end users can enter their prolonged URLs and get shortened versions. It may be a simple form with a Online page.
Databases: A database is necessary to retail store the mapping involving the initial extended URL plus the shortened Edition. Databases like MySQL, PostgreSQL, or NoSQL selections like MongoDB can be utilized.
Redirection Logic: This is the backend logic that can take the shorter URL and redirects the consumer towards the corresponding long URL. This logic is generally executed in the world wide web server or an application layer.
API: Numerous URL shorteners provide an API to ensure that 3rd-occasion programs can programmatically shorten URLs and retrieve the original extensive URLs.
three. Building the URL Shortening Algorithm
The crux of the URL shortener lies in its algorithm for converting a protracted URL into a short 1. Many solutions could be used, for example:

Hashing: The extended URL can be hashed into a set-dimensions string, which serves given that the short URL. Nevertheless, hash collisions (unique URLs resulting in exactly the same hash) must be managed.
Base62 Encoding: A person typical technique is to use Base62 encoding (which utilizes 62 figures: 0-nine, A-Z, and a-z) on an integer ID. The ID corresponds for the entry during the databases. This method makes certain that the brief URL is as brief as you can.
Random String Era: A different solution is to crank out a random string of a hard and fast duration (e.g., six figures) and Examine if it’s previously in use inside the databases. Otherwise, it’s assigned towards the extensive URL.
four. Database Administration
The databases schema to get a URL shortener is frequently simple, with two Major fields:

ID: A novel identifier for every URL entry.
Extended URL: The initial URL that should be shortened.
Short URL/Slug: The shorter Model of the URL, frequently stored as a unique string.
In combination with these, you should retail store metadata like the development day, expiration date, and the quantity of occasions the small URL has long been accessed.

five. Dealing with Redirection
Redirection is really a significant Section of the URL shortener's Procedure. Any time a user clicks on a short URL, the services ought to immediately retrieve the original URL in the database and redirect the consumer utilizing an HTTP 301 (lasting redirect) or 302 (temporary redirect) status code.

Functionality is key below, as the process needs to be just about instantaneous. Strategies like databases indexing and caching (e.g., utilizing Redis or Memcached) is often employed to speed up the retrieval course of action.

6. Security Criteria
Safety is a big concern in URL shorteners:

Malicious URLs: A URL shortener might be abused to distribute malicious backlinks. Applying URL validation, blacklisting, or integrating with 3rd-celebration safety expert services to examine URLs before shortening them can mitigate this threat.
Spam Avoidance: Charge limiting and CAPTCHA can avert abuse by spammers endeavoring to produce A huge number of limited URLs.
seven. Scalability
As being the URL shortener grows, it might have to take care of millions of URLs and redirect requests. This requires a scalable architecture, probably involving load balancers, distributed databases, and microservices.

Load Balancing: Distribute site visitors throughout many servers to handle high hundreds.
Dispersed Databases: Use databases which can scale horizontally, like Cassandra or MongoDB.
Microservices: Different problems like URL shortening, analytics, and redirection into distinctive products and services to boost scalability and maintainability.
eight. Analytics
URL shorteners often deliver analytics to trace how often a brief URL is clicked, where by the website traffic is coming from, together with other valuable metrics. This needs logging Each individual redirect And maybe integrating with analytics platforms.
